This adds DT bindings describing the TLMM controller on Qualcomm Nord
platforms, the pinctrl driver and enables it in arm64 defconfig.

Keeping functions like this split per pin forces the DT author to
write per-pin states. We avoid this by dropping/adjusting the function
suffix.

The only case where we want to see a suffix for a given endpoint is when
it's necessary to allow us to select some secondary function of that pin
(e.g. we've seen QUP SE instances that spread their 4 pins pair-wise
across only two pins, with two different functions).

[..]
> +	msm_mux_qup3_se0_l0_mira,
> +	msm_mux_qup3_se0_l0_mirb,
> +	msm_mux_qup3_se0_l1_mira,
> +	msm_mux_qup3_se0_l1_mirb,

Here's such example, where the first two pins of qup3_se0 have two
different mappings on gpio 102/103 (for some reason). So, we somehow
need two functions for these.

> +	msm_mux_qup3_se0_l2,
> +	msm_mux_qup3_se0_l3,
> +	msm_mux_qup3_se0_l4,
> +	msm_mux_qup3_se0_l5,
> +	msm_mux_qup3_se0_l6,

But in order to select qup3_se0 muxing on pins 102-108 the DT author
need to write 6 different pinctrl states; where 1-2 should suffice.
